강의

멘토링

로드맵

인프런 커뮤니티 질문&답변

dkuturing2023님의 프로필 이미지
dkuturing2023

작성한 질문수

[리뉴얼] 맛집 지도앱 만들기 (React Native & NestJS)

[1-5] 프로젝트 생성 및 ruby 에러 해결

Emulator terminated with exit code -529697949

작성

·

331

0

질문 작성시 꼭 참고해주세요

  • 현재 문제(또는 에러)와 코드(또는 github)를 첨부해주세요.

     

  • 맥/윈도우, 안드로이드/iOS, ReactNative, Node 버전 등의 개발환경을 함께 적어주시면 도움이 됩니다.

     

  • 에러메세지는 일부분이 아닌 전체 상황을 올려주세요. (

    일부만 자르거나 복사하지말아주세요.)

     

  • 개발환경/코드에 대한 정보가 없을경우 답변이 어렵습니다.

    애뮬레이터가 계속 실행이 안되어서 log를 보았더니 제목과 같은 오류 코드와 함께 계속 실행되지 않습니다

info Opening the app on Android...

info JS server already running.

info Launching emulator...

info Installing the app...

> Task :gradle-plugin:compileKotlin UP-TO-DATE

> Task :gradle-plugin:compileJava NO-SOURCE

> Task :gradle-plugin:pluginDescriptors UP-TO-DATE

> Task :gradle-plugin:processResources UP-TO-DATE

> Task :gradle-plugin:classes UP-TO-DATE

> Task :gradle-plugin:jar UP-TO-DATE

> Task :gradle-plugin:inspectClassesForKotlinIC UP-TO-DATE

> Task :app:buildCodegenCLI SKIPPED

> Task :app:generateCodegenSchemaFromJavaScript SKIPPED

> Task :app:generateCodegenArtifactsFromSchema SKIPPED

> Task :app:generatePackageList

> Task :app:preBuild

> Task :app:preDebugBuild

> Task :app:compileDebugAidl NO-SOURCE

> Task :app:compileDebugRenderscript NO-SOURCE

> Task :app:generateDebugBuildConfig UP-TO-DATE

> Task :app:javaPreCompileDebug UP-TO-DATE

> Task :app:checkDebugAarMetadata UP-TO-DATE

> Task :app:generateDebugResValues UP-TO-DATE

> Task :app:mapDebugSourceSetPaths UP-TO-DATE

> Task :app:generateDebugResources UP-TO-DATE

> Task :app:mergeDebugResources UP-TO-DATE

> Task :app:createDebugCompatibleScreenManifests UP-TO-DATE

> Task :app:extractDeepLinksDebug UP-TO-DATE

> Task :app:processDebugMainManifest UP-TO-DATE

> Task :app:processDebugManifest UP-TO-DATE

> Task :app:processDebugManifestForPackage UP-TO-DATE

> Task :app:processDebugResources UP-TO-DATE

> Task :app:compileDebugJavaWithJavac UP-TO-DATE

> Task :app:mergeDebugShaders UP-TO-DATE

> Task :app:compileDebugShaders NO-SOURCE

> Task :app:generateDebugAssets UP-TO-DATE

> Task :app:mergeDebugAssets UP-TO-DATE

> Task :app:compressDebugAssets UP-TO-DATE

> Task :app:processDebugJavaRes NO-SOURCE

> Task :app:mergeDebugJavaResource UP-TO-DATE

> Task :app:checkDebugDuplicateClasses UP-TO-DATE

> Task :app:desugarDebugFileDependencies UP-TO-DATE

> Task :app:mergeExtDexDebug UP-TO-DATE

> Task :app:mergeLibDexDebug UP-TO-DATE

> Task :app:dexBuilderDebug UP-TO-DATE

> Task :app:mergeProjectDexDebug UP-TO-DATE

> Task :app:mergeDebugJniLibFolders UP-TO-DATE

> Task :app:mergeDebugNativeLibs UP-TO-DATE

> Task :app:stripDebugDebugSymbols UP-TO-DATE

> Task :app:validateSigningDebug UP-TO-DATE

> Task :app:writeDebugAppMetadata UP-TO-DATE

> Task :app:writeDebugSigningConfigVersions UP-TO-DATE

> Task :app:packageDebug UP-TO-DATE

> Task :app:createDebugApkListingFileRedirect UP-TO-DATE

> Task :app:installDebug FAILED

38 actionable tasks: 2 executed, 36 up-to-date

info 💡 Tip: Make sure that you have set up your development environment correctly, by running react-native doctor. To read more about doctor command visit: https://github.com/react-native-community/cli/blob/main/packages/cli-doctor/README.md#doctor

FAILURE: Build failed with an exception.

* What went wrong:

Execution failed for task ':app:installDebug'.

> com.android.builder.testing.api.DeviceException: No connected devices!

* Try:

> Run with --stacktrace option to get the stack trace.

> Run with --info or --debug option to get more log output.

> Run with --scan to get full insights.

* Get more help at https://help.gradle.org

BUILD FAILED in 11s

info Run CLI with --verbose flag for more details.

답변 3

0

Kyo님의 프로필 이미지
Kyo
지식공유자

안드로이드 스튜디오에서 에뮬레이터를 켜고 해보시겠어요?

0

dkuturing2023님의 프로필 이미지
dkuturing2023
질문자

There was an error finding the Android SDK root

doctor를 실행하면 이렇게 나오는데... 환경변수에 오류가 있는건가요? 사용자명이 한글로 설정되어 있어 어쩔 수 없이 mklink를 이용하여 c드라이브에 영어명 폴더를 하나 만들어서 연결했습니다

0

안녕하세요, 인프런 AI 인턴입니다. dkuturing2023님께서 겪고 계신 이 문제는 Android 에뮬레이터가 실행되지 않으며 ‘Emulator terminated with exit code -529697949’라는 오류를 주는 상황입니다. 여기에 대해 몇 가지 해결 방법을 제안드리겠습니다.

문제의 원인:

해당 오류 코드는 일반적으로 에뮬레이터의 시작이 정상적으로 이루어지지 않았음을 의미합니다. 앱을 설치할 안드로이드 디바이스가 연결되지 않았을 때 자주 발생합니다.

해결 방법:

  1. Android 가상 디바이스 확인 및 실행:

    • Android Studio의 AVD Manager에서 현재 설정된 가상 디바이스(에뮬레이터)를 확인하세요.
    • 생성된 에뮬레이터가 제대로 설정되어 있는지 확인하고, 실행시켜 주십시오. 실행된 후 터미널에서 adb devices를 통해 연결 상태를 확인하세요.
  2. 에뮬레이터 설정 조정:

    • 에뮬레이터 설정에서 Graphics 옵션을 Hardware - GLES 2.0에서 Software로 설정해 보세요. 이는 그래픽 가속의 충돌 문제를 피하도록 돕습니다.
    • 메모리 설정을 늘려서 에뮬레이터가 더 많은 시스템 자원을 사용할 수 있게 하세요.
  3. 환경 변수 및 설정 확인:

    • ANDROID_HOME과 같은 환경 변수가 정확히 설정되었는지 확인하세요. 이 변수는 Android SDK의 설치 경로를 가리켜야 합니다.
  4. adb 서버 재시작:

    • 명령 프롬프트나 터미널에서 다음 명령어를 사용하여 adb 서버를 다시 시작할 수 있습니다:
      
      adb kill-server
      adb start-server
      

  5. 개발 환경 점검:

    • npx react-native doctor 명령어를 실행하여 개발 환경에 누락된 부분이나 설정 오류가 있는지 점검해 보세요.

관련 유사한 사례로 문제와 해결 방안을 참고하시려면 아래 링크를 방문해 보세요:
- 윈도우: react navigation 강의 듣다가 생긴 오류
- 시뮬레이터가 작동하지 않아요ㅠ

위의 방법들을 모두 시도해 보시고, 여전히 문제가 해결되지 않으시면 더 구체적인 오류 메시지나 환경 정보를 포함하여 다시 질문해 주세요.

저는 질문자님의 이해를 돕고자 지식공유자님의 기존 답변을 참고하여 유사한 답변 링크를 추천해드리고 있습니다.
현재 베타 기능으로 답변이 만족스럽지 않을 수 있는 점 양해 부탁드립니다. 🙏
추가적으로 궁금한 점이 있으시면, 이어서 질문해 주세요. 곧 지식공유자께서 답변해 주실 것입니다.

dkuturing2023님의 프로필 이미지
dkuturing2023
질문자

Android

Adb - No devices and/or emulators connected. Please create emulator with Android Studio or connect Android device.

✓ JDK - Required to compile Java code

✓ Android Studio - Required for building and installing your app on Android

Android SDK - Required for building and installing your app on Android

- Versions found: N/A

- Version supported: 33.0.0

✓ ANDROID_HOME - Environment variable that points to your Android SDK installation

Errors: 2

Warnings: 0

Attempting to fix 2 issues...

Android

Adb

√ Select the device / emulator you want to use » Emulator Pixel_5_API_33 (disconnected)

Adb

There was an error finding the Android SDK root

dkuturing2023님의 프로필 이미지
dkuturing2023

작성한 질문수

질문하기